The catch composition of bottom trawls is commonly refined and improved through changes in codend design. Measures like reducing the number of meshes in codend circumference or turning diamond netting by 90 degrees are well known to improve the size selectivity of fish species with rounded cross-sectional shape. The effect of shifting from a diamond mesh codend (T0) to a 90° turned mesh codend (T90) on the size selectivity of seven commercially important species in the Mediterranean bottom trawl fishery was evaluated. During sea trials conducted in the north-western Adriatic, two experimental codends made of 54 mm nominal mesh size netting that differed only in mesh configuration were alternately mounted on the same trawl. Small‐scale driftnets (SSDs) have been historically used in the Mediterranean without major environmental concern. The introduction of large‐scale driftnets caused unwanted catches of protected species. Specific regulations were therefore issued in European waters, culminating in a proposed moratorium on SSDs.
